WebOct 7, 2013 · Phospholipid:diacylglycerol acyltransferase (PDAT) and diacylglycerol:acyl CoA acyltransferase play overlapping roles in triacylglycerol (TAG) assembly in Arabidopsis, and are essential for seed and pollen development, but the functional importance of PDAT in vegetative tissues remains largely unknown. WebLegend. Settings. Analysis WebMar 31, 2024 · Phospholipid: diacylglycerol acyltransferase (PDAT) was first reported in plants by Dahlqvist et al. and characterised further by the same group . Since PDAT allows the formation of TAG via an acyl-CoA independent pathway, its relative contribution to TAG formation compared with DGAT has been the subject of considerable study in ...
